In this episode of "Fueling Growth," we dive into a critical aspect of running an auto repair shop: payment security. As the digital landscape continues to evolve, so do the tactics of fraudsters aiming to exploit vulnerabilities in payment systems. Join us as we explore essential strategies to safeguard your business from fraudulent transactions. We'll discuss best practices for implementing secure payment methods, recognizing potential fraud attempts, and maintaining customer trust. This episode equips you with the knowledge needed to protect your bottom line while enhancing your reputation. Whether you're a seasoned shop owner or just starting, these insights will help you navigate the complexities of payment security, ensuring your customers feel safe and secure when choosing your services.
